A lot of home appliances operate on your home's electrical system: They use Air Conditioner current from the circuit circuitry in your house. Little devices deal with 110-120-volt circuits, and the plugs on their cords have two blades. Large or significant home appliances, such as a/c, dryers, and ranges, generally require 220-240-volt circuitry and can not be run on 110-120-volt circuits. Big home appliances are wired with a grounding wire; their plugs have 2 blades and a prong. This type of device must be plugged into a grounded outlet-- one with openings to accept both blades and grounding prong-- or grounded with an unique adapter plug. All devices are labeled-- either on a metal plate or on the appliance housing-- with their power requirements in watts and volts, and in some cases in amps.

Little appliances are normally relatively easy makers. They may include an easy heating element, a fan, a set of blades, or rotating beaters connected to a drive shaft; or they may have two or three simple mechanical linkages. Repair work to these devices are usually similarly easy. Big home appliances are more complex-- one major device, such as a cleaning device, may have a motor, a timer, and a pump, as well as different valves, switches, and solenoids. With this type of home appliance, issues can happen in either the control ΕΠΙΣΚΕΥΗ ΟΙΚΙΑΚΩΝ ΣΥΣΚΕΥΩΝ gadgets or the mechanical/power components. Failure of a control device might affect one operation or the entire home appliance; failure of a mechanical/power device normally affects only the functions that depend upon that gadget. When a major home appliance breaks down, knowing how to diagnose the problem is as essential as knowing how to fix it.

Due to the fact that significant devices are so complicated, it generally isn't apparent where a malfunction is. (Numerous newer devices consist of electronic diagnostics that can be translated from the owner's handbook.) The primary step is to decide whether the problem is in a control gadget or a mechanical device. In a clothes dryer, for instance, the control gadgets govern the heat, and the mechanical elements turn the drum. Which system is impacted? If the drum turns, however the dryer doesn't heat, the issue is in the control system. If the dryer heats, but the drum does not turn, the problem is mechanical. This sort of analysis can be used to identify the type of failure-- control system or mechanical system-- in all large home appliances.

To find out precisely what the problem is, you should check each part of the affected system to find the malfunctioning part. This isn't as challenging as it sounds, because home appliance components work together in a logical sequence. Beginning with the most basic possibilities, you can test the components one by one to separate the cause of the failure.

Repairing Major Appliances

There are three really crucial guidelines you should follow when you attempt to make any kind of appliance repair work. Do not ever attempt to conserve time or money by neglecting these guidelines. You will not save anything at all, and you could wind up harming yourself or ruining the device.

Constantly make sure the electric power and/or the gas supply to the device is disconnected before you check the device to diagnose the issue or make any repairs. If you turn the power on to examine your work after making a repair work, do not touch the home appliance; simply turn the power on and observe. If modifications are needed, turn the power off before you make them.

If the parts of a home appliance are held together with screws, bolts, plugs, and other take-apart fasteners, you can most likely make any required repair work. If the parts are held together with rivets or welds, do not attempt to repair the appliance yourself. Call a professional service person.

In many cases, broken or malfunctioning home appliance parts can be changed more quickly and cheaply than they can be fixed by you or an expert. Replace any broken or malfunctioning parts with new parts made specifically for that device. If you can not discover a specific replacement for the damaged part, it's all right to replace a similar part as long as it fits into the old area. In this case, describe the maker's directions for installation.

Home appliance parts are offered from home appliance service centers, appliance-repair dealerships, and appliance-parts shops. You don't always need to go to a specific brand-name home appliance parts center to get the parts and service you require for brand-name home appliances, so you do have some shopping/service options. If available, search on the Web for replacement parts.Before you make any home appliance repair work, ensure the home appliance is receiving power. Lack of power is the most common cause of device failure. Prior to you begin the screening and diagnosis procedure, take these preliminary steps:

Examine to make certain that the appliance is properly and strongly plugged in which the cord, the plug, and the outlet are working appropriately. To determine whether an outlet is working, check it SERVICE ΟΙΚΙΑΚΩΝ ΣΥΣΚΕΥΩΝ ΑΘΗΝΑ with a voltage tester.

Inspect to ensure the merges and/or breaker that control the circuit have not blown or tripped. There may be more than one electrical entryway panel for your home, particularly for 220-240-volt appliances such as ranges and air conditioning system. Look for blown merges or tripped circuit breakers at both the main panel and the separate panel.

Inspect to make sure fuses and/or breakers in the device itself are not blown or tripped. Press the reset buttons to bring back power to home appliances such as washers, dryers, and ranges. Some ranges have different plug-type merges for oven operation; make certain these merges have actually not blown.

If the appliance utilizes gas or water, check to ensure it is getting an appropriate supply.
